EVs for All America founder Mike Murphy just went cross-country, 3,000 miles with zero gas and plenty of American factory tours in his brand new Porsche Cayenne Electric. Max and Mike catch up to see how the journey went, unpack how easy and fast charging has become, and the highs and lows of seeing free world auto investment in a landscape of turbulent US policy contrasted by clear global progress in electrification.

Some highlights of the journey and their conversation:
- A drone mishap at a windy Bucc-ees station in Texas
- A missed highway exit for a critical cahrging stop and an opportune turnout that let Mike roast some fancy tires on gravel
- Mike's stops at from Tesla, Honda, Francis Energy, LG Energy that tell a story of American investment
- The duo's recommendations on the best non-Porsche road tripping EVs to buy for the rest of us
